Why You Need a Personal Injury Lawyer
-
Legal Expertise & Guidance
Personal injury laws can be complex, and insurance companies often take advantage of victims who are unfamiliar with legal procedures. A skilled lawyer understands the legal system, ensures your rights are protected, and helps you navigate the process efficiently. -
Maximizing Compensation
Insurance companies may try to offer settlements that are much lower than what you deserve. A personal injury lawyer will assess all damages—including medical bills, lost wages, and emotional distress—and fight to get you the maximum compensation. -
Negotiation with Insurance Companies
Insurance companies have teams of lawyers and adjusters whose job is to minimize payouts. A personal injury attorney will handle negotiations on your behalf, ensuring you don’t settle for less than you deserve. -
Proving Liability & Gathering Evidence
Establishing who is at fault in an accident is crucial for a successful claim. A lawyer will gather evidence such as medical records, police reports, and witness statements to strengthen your case. -
No Upfront Costs
Most personal injury lawyers work on a contingency basis, meaning you don’t pay them unless they win your case. This allows victims to get legal representation without financial strain.
When Should You Contact a Lawyer?
-
If you have sustained serious injuries
-
If the insurance company denies your claim or offers a low settlement
-
If there is a dispute over who is at fault
-
If you are facing long-term or permanent disability due to the accident
